: Modern professional environments have moved toward the PSA Evolution A (Core XS) . This upgraded version features an 800 MHz ARM CPU , 8GB Flash memory, and DoIP (Diagnostics over IP) Ethernet support, which is necessary for the massive data transfers required by the latest PSA vehicles. 2. Most handheld scanners only communicate with the Engine Control Unit (ECU). The PSA XS Evolution, paired with , talks to every single module in the car. This includes: BSI (Built-in Systems Interface): The "brain" of the car. Airbag and ABS/ESP modules. Climate control and infotainment systems. Suspension and power steering units.
